Respiratory pasteurellosis: infection or colonization?
Laura Muntaner1, Jose M Suriñach, Daniel Zuñiga
1Department of Internal Medicine, Hospital Universitario Vall d'Hebron, Barcelona, Spain. 38535lmm@comb.es
Pasteurella multocida respiratory infections are rare, typically affecting individuals with compromised health. Early differentiation between colonization and infection is crucial for timely antibiotic therapy.

Background:
- Pasteurella multocida respiratory infections are infrequent, often seen in patients with pre-existing lung conditions, advanced age, or weakened immune systems.
- Understanding the clinical and microbiological aspects of these infections is vital for effective management.
Purpose of the Study:
- To describe the clinical and microbiological features of Pasteurella multocida lower respiratory tract infections.
- To highlight the importance of distinguishing between colonization and infection for prompt treatment.
Main Methods:
- Retrospective analysis of 14 patients with Pasteurella multocida isolated from lower respiratory samples.
- Data collected over a 21-year period (1986-2006).
Main Results:
- Pasteurella multocida isolation from lower respiratory tract samples occurred in 14 patients over 21 years.
- Clinical and microbiological data were analyzed to characterize these rare infections.
Conclusions:
- Respiratory infections caused by Pasteurella multocida are uncommon but significant in specific patient populations.
- Differentiating colonization from infection is key to initiating appropriate and early antibiotic treatment, improving patient outcomes.
